In case you didn't know there is also a command line version of Profile Migrator. It provides the same functions as the GUI version, but is more useful for automating migrations.If you want to find out, what exactly the command line version can do for you, open an elevated command prompt and switch to the folder where Profile Migrator is installed.
Default(x86):"C:\Program Files\sepago\Profile Migrator"
Default(x64):"C:\Program Files (x86)\sepago\Profile Migrator"
cd %your_path_to_the_pm_installation%
Now just type in PMCommand and you will get back all available parameters with a short description. In the screenshot below you see a sample of the output.

On top of the parameters there is also an example given to you at the end. If you want to get more examples type in PMCommand -Examples

Let's do another example on our own:
Migration of one profile without a migration project, target path same as source path, on conflict overwrite and write the output into a specified logfile.
PMCommand.exe -Directory:\\Server\Share\Profiles\User -DefaultProfile:\\TargetMachine\c$\Users\Default -UseSourcePath -ConflictHandling:overwrite -Logfile:\\Server\Share\Logfiles\User.log
